How much does a good photographer get paid?

A professional photographer's average salary varies based on experience, specialization, and location, but typically ranges from $30,000 to $70,000 annually. Skilled photographers with a strong portfolio and proficiency in editing tools can earn higher wages, especially in commercial or specialized fields like fashion or advertising.

Is a photographer a high paying job?

Photographers' salaries vary based on experience, specialization, location, and client base. While some professional photographers earn high incomes, many entry-level or part-time photographers have average or lower earnings, making it a job with variable pay rather than consistently high wages.
